    3. Harry Junior Hansen, born 3 Jun 1920 at Walnut Township, Fremont County, Iowa, died 5 April 2006 at the Veteran's Administration Hospital in Walla Walla, Walla Walla County, Washington. Memorial services coordinated by Burns Mortuary of Hermiston, Oregon, will be held at the LDS Church in Hermiston on April 10, 2006. Harry was the son of Harry Emanuel Hansen and Mable Grace (Mitchell) Hansen, who were married 14 Oct 1915 at the Methodist Church in Harlan, Shelby Co., Iowa. Mable died in 1923 and for two years Harry Junior was raised by his Danish paternal grandparents in Harlan, Iowa. In 1925, his father married Mildred Ester Holtz at Shelby Co., Iowa. On 6 Dec 1928, daughter Lois Marie Hansen was born at Shelby, Shelby Co., Iowa. She later married Edward Hanske. In 1932, Mildred died. Lois was adopted by her maternal grandparents, with whom Harry Junior also lived for a year. In 1933, his father married Pearl Pauline (Petersen) Larson on 4 Aug 1933 at Avoca, Pottawatomie Co., IA. Pearl's son Laurence Timm Larsen (b. 23 Dec 1924 Council Bluffs) joined the family, and in 1934 son Michael Joseph "Joe" Hansen was born (Council Bluffs). The family resided in Council Bluffs in 1938 when Harry Junior graduated from high school, and through Harry Emanuel's death in 1950, Timm's death in 1987, and Pearl's death in 1996. Harry Junior served his country during World War II in the Army Air Corps, and was stationed for a time in Pendleton, Oregon, where he met his future wife, Zelma Maurine Sutton, at a military base dance. She reminded him of his mother, and during their first dance, he declared that he had decided to marry her. On 18 Feb 1945, they were married at Pendleton, Umatilla Co., OR. Maurine was the daughter of Lester Carlyle Sutton and Stella May (Perkins) Sutton, who resided near Stanfield, OR. Harry and Maurine were married for more than 61 years. Harry earned his living as an electrician with Boeing Company and (briefly) with Lockheed Aircraft, and retired in 1982. During the Cold War, he helped build missile silos in North Dakota. His hobbies were raising and riding horses and learning about his ancestors through genealogy. The family resided in Washington, Oregon, and California. In 1973, they purchased a small farm outside of Stanfield, Oregon where Maurine's paternal grandparents had once resided. There Maurine continues to reside, next door to her son Wendell and youngest brother, Aaron. She has the support of hundreds of family members and friends to carry her safely through this difficult time. Messages of sympathy and support are welcome. Harry and Maurine had three children: * Carol Grace Hansen Hollingsworth Devine, b. 20 May 1949, Seattle, King Co., WA, now residing at West Richland, WA. * Wendell Harry Hansen, b. 10 June 1951, Seattle, King Co., WA, now residing near Stanfield, OR. * Jeffrey Lyle "Jeff" Hansen, b. 16 Jul 1967, Bellevue, King Co., WA, now residing at Hermiston, OR. Harry lived to see his five grandchildren grow to adulthood, and to enjoy the infancy of two of his three great grandsons. Following a prolonged battle with failing health, Harry died of heart failure while holding the hand of his wife, and suffered no pain. The family acknowledges with deep appreciation the tremendous support of the United States Veteran's Administration hospitals in Portland and Walla Walla through the final years of Dad's life. To all those who helped our father and mother research Dad's ancestral line, we extend our sincere thanks. Carol and Wendell will continue to advance the research as life permits. In 1959, the family joined the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-Day Saints, and Harry and Maurine became avid genealogists. Harry renewed contact with a multitude of distant relatives and collected invaluable genealogical information now of great assistance to Hansen, Mitchell, Sorensen and Ferguson researchers in Iowa and across the United States.
